Study Summary
RATIONALE: Radiolabeled monoclonal antibodies, such as iodine I 131 tositumomab and yttrium Y 90 ibritumomab tiuxetan, can find cancer cells and carry cancer-killing substances to them without harming normal cells. This may be an effective treatment for non-Hodgkin's lymphoma. PURPOSE: This clinical trial is studying the side effects, best dose, and how well iodine I 131 tositumomab or yttrium Y 90 ibritumomab tiuxetan works in treating patients with non-Hodgkin's lymphoma.
